credits

from Sheep, released June 10, 2019
Brent McCormick plays guitar and sings
Billy Bacci plays keys
Eric Godsey plas drums and sings
Fitzhugh Ralph Mason II plays the bass

Recorded and Mixed by Adrian Olsen of Montrose Recording
Mastered by Allen Bergendahl of Viking Recording

Made in Richmond, Virginia
